Required subjects for Biomedical Science BSc Hons at University of Surrey

Overall: BBB We do not include General Studies or Critical Thinking in our offers. Required subjects: Chemistry or Biology grade B and a second science or Mathematics. Applicants taking the Science Practical Endorsement are required to pass.

So far, all of the modules have been extremely interesting but also challenging. In one of our modules last semester, we were able to submit anonymous questions on the discussion board, which I think is ingenious, because it means that more people are likely to post any questions they have without fear of sounding silly. read more
